PHILADELPHIA (973espn.com) — In case you didn't know the Eagles were down to their third option at kicker during Sunday's 37-9 win over Dallas.
Typically the emergency kicker for Dave Fipp is Chris Maragos but the veteran special teams star is done for the season after undergoing surgery earlier this month for a PCL injury suffered in his right knee against Carolina in Week 6...

PHILADELPHIA (973espn.com) — The Eagles officially lost their leader on special teams Thursday when Chris Maragos was placed on injured reserve with a knee injury.
The veteran hurt himself while covering a punt in the fourth quarter against Carolina a week ago...

PHILADELPHIA (973espn.com) - The Eagles have consistently had one of the NFL’s better special teams operations under Dave Fipp and one of the keystones of that success was rewarded with a new three-year deal on Thursday.
The Eagles extended safety Chris Maragos, their leading tackler on STs, through the 2019 season...
